15, see text Zimirina is a genus of long-spinneret ground spiders that was first described by R. de Dalmas in 1919.
[2] It was transferred to the ground spiders in 2018,[3] but was returned to Prodidominae in 2022.
[1] As of August 2022[update] it contains fifteen species, found in Africa, Portugal, Italy, Spain, and on Saint Helena:[1]
